How old do you have to be to rent a car in Dumgoyne?
Drivers 21 and above can get on the road in Dumgoyne in a rental vehicle. If you're a young driver, a daily surcharge applies. You'll usually be limited to a few car categories, such as compact and mid-size, and may also have to purchase inclusive insurance. Be sure to enter the correct age of the main driver when booking to learn if any restrictions apply.
What do you need to rent a car in Dumgoyne?
Generally, all you'll need is a valid driver's licence and a credit card in the same name when collecting the keys to your car. You may also need your own proof of coverage if you choose to opt out of the company's insurance policy. These requirements often differ between rental outlets, so it's always wise to read the fine print.
What side of the road do you drive on in Dumgoyne?
Unlike the States, motorists in Dumgoyne drive on the left-hand side. Having the steering wheel and some controls on the opposite side can also take some getting used to. Take a moment to familiarise yourself with the car and its quirks before embarking on your journey.
